What is another word for more misbelieving?

Pronunciation: [mˈɔː mɪsbɪlˈiːvɪŋ] (IPA)

The word "misbelieving" refers to someone who does not believe in something, or holds false beliefs. Some synonyms for "more misbelieving" include incredulous, skeptical, dubious, distrustful, and unbelieving. Each of these words implies a lack of faith or trust in something, whether it be an individual, a concept, or an idea. In some cases, these words may also suggest a certain level of cynicism or pessimism regarding the topic at hand. Ultimately, the use of these synonyms will depend on the specific context in which they are being used, and the connotations that are desired.

What are the opposite words for more misbelieving?

The word "misbelieving" refers to the act of not believing or having doubts about something. Antonyms for this term include "believing," "trusting," "having faith," "accepting," and "having confidence." When a person is more misbelieving, they can be described as being more doubtful, suspicious, or uncertain. Conversely, when a person is less misbelieving, they are more likely to be open-minded, accepting, and trusting. These antonyms are helpful when trying to convey a positive or negative attitude towards a particular topic or situation. Using the right antonym can help to clarify the intended meaning and convey a specific tone or mood.
